Output e8984aa399e8ad113e391dd43521d002f9a1a632d1a64bf1ae673d25ad52eb72:0

value
12939122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b66178b4d17358e04c72bbe1f285f4d44690cd OP_EQUAL
address
MPeNwTiv83wPzGaBxokf6Mir4JLNdmn2d9
transaction
e8984aa399e8ad113e391dd43521d002f9a1a632d1a64bf1ae673d25ad52eb72
spent
true